Lords of Dogtown (2005)

Cast: Heath Ledger (Skip), Rebecca De Mornay (Philaine), Emile Hirsch (Jay)
For complete cast, see IMDb's Lords of Dogtown page.

If there's a story in Lords of Dogtown, my husband and I couldn't find it. I'm sure it's a great movie for people who are really into skating. That's not us, but it still looked pretty interesting. I was wrong.

We didn't even finish watching the DVD.

Grade: D

The Girl Next Door (2004)

Cast: Emile Hirsch (Matthew Kidman), Elisha Cuthbert (Danielle), Timothy Olyphant (Kelly)
For complete cast list, see IMDb's The Girl Next Door page.

This was a fun movie. A lot funnier than we anticipated going into it and a fun way to spend a couple hours. I'd definitely say you should rent it if you don't have time to see it before it leaves theatres.

The Girl Next Door is a great teen romantic comedy that's a lot funnier than the previews showed. There's a really good cast and directing.

Grade: B+

The Emperor's Club (2002)

Cast: Kevin Kline (William Hundert), Emile Hirsch (Sedgewick Bell)
For complete cast info, see IMDb's The Emperor's Club page.

This movie is probably a bit too much like Dead Poets Society (one of my favorite movies) to do well in movie theaters, but it was a very well done movie and I would recommend it.

If you loved Dead Poets Society, you'll really enjoy The Emperor's Club. If not, you should probably skip it.

Grade: B+
